The book contains proceedings of the online conference conducted on May 12-13, 2022 and organized by the University of Warmia and Mazury in Olsztyn (Allenstein), Poland. The conference concerned multiple forms of ritual behavior practiced in various cultural, historical, and societal contexts, including ‟ghost marriageˮ in Taiwan; jeroky ñembo’e of the Paraguayan Guarani; rites surrounding the childbirth on Flores, Indonesia; family-related rituals in Cameroon; Ancient Roman forms of commemoration of departed ancestors; Catholic rituals as a form of ‟discipliningˮ in the colonial context of German Togo.
